Transaction 90e1615189cea0b7f13a1b29d178686fe064f383028c8d73ef5495dfadb29452
1 Input
1 Output
-
90e1615189cea0b7f13a1b29d178686fe064f383028c8d73ef5495dfadb29452:0
- value
- 21431861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ca79956d84fd7f68bdef4d64bb817ae646e79707 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KTb9XweXttkdwcWvHTxvE18nHg6sY7929